As kids, playing in the sand always delighted us. This childhood entertainment is taken to a new level by means of Dune bashing n Rajasthan! Better known as desert safari, this is a form of off-roading, using an off-road vehicle to explore sand dunes of dessert lands. In India, Rajasthan is the most popular venue for this adventure activity.
Experiencing the wide expanse of the desert, the ethereal magic of sunset and a lively Rajasthani entertainment makes for a splendid night to remember.

Begin your desert adventure at Jodhpur, a fortress-city at the edge of the Thar Desert. Then travel to Jaisalmer to see its unforgettable golden fortress. Situated 260 km away from Delhi and 240 km from Agra, Jaipur is a bustling capital city and a business centre with all the trapping of modern metropolis but yet flavored strongly with an age-old charm that never fails to surprise a traveler. Called the ‘Pink City’, Jaipur catches the admiration of any visitor.
Jaipur is well connected by road, rail, and air from (Delhi, Agra, Mumbai, Kolkata, Chennai, Bikaner, Jodhpur, Udaipur, Ahmedabad) with a single international flight to Dubai from Sanganer Airport of Jaipur. There is also special luxury train, the Palace on wheels, which starts from Delhi every Wednesday from September to April on a round trip of Rajasthan, the first stop being Jaipur.

The Sam Dunes:
The Sam dunes are the most charming spot around Jaisalmer, and possibly the whole of western Rajasthan. Sam Sand Dunes in Rajasthan is located 42 kms from Jaisalmer in the midst of the desert wilderness of the Thar Desert. The Sam Sand dunes are a tourist hot spot in more ways than one. 3km long, 1km wide and as much as half a kilometer high, the dunes are as unreliable as they are scenic. There is no vegetation here and the swirling air currents are almost as intense as the sandstorms in the Sahara.
Sitting there in the evening with the sun setting, listening to traditional musical instrument, one might feel that time has come to a stand halt. An overnight trip to the area is a must if one really wants to enjoy the sights and sounds, the ruins and the temples. Sleeping out in the open, stretched out on the sands facing the sky is an out of the world experience.
During the desert festival, the Sam Dunes really come alive with a sound and light show, and dance and music, which reverberate for a long time. Immersed in a laid-back haze, the beautiful Sam sand dunes create engrossing and absorbing views. The winds draw patterns on the constantly drifting sand dunes.
Best time to visit Rajasthan:
The best times to visit Rajasthan would be during winter season. The months from November to April are ideal, with December and January the busiest months. And, this is the ideal time to do dune bashing in Rajasthan.
